模型生成方法、设备和存储介质技术

技术编号:37315765 阅读:15 留言:0更新日期:2023-04-21 22:57
本发明专利技术公开了一种模型生成方法、设备和存储介质,所述方法包括:获取预设模型和界面对应的数据词典;根据预设模型和所述数据词典生成所述模型的一级框架;获取接口信号对应的接口类型,并获取所述接口信号对应的信号类型;根据所述接口类型和所述信号类型生成信号处理的二级框架。本发明专利技术提高了接口信号传输的安全性和处理效率,节省了人力成本和时间成本。节省了人力成本和时间成本。节省了人力成本和时间成本。

【技术实现步骤摘要】
模型生成方法、设备和存储介质


[0001]本专利技术涉及车辆管理
,尤其涉及一种模型生成方法、设备和存储介质。

技术介绍

[0002]动力软件通常分为应用层和底层软件,当通信网络复杂时,且通信协议在开发阶段频繁迭代时,为了便于同步更新,开发进度可控,以及减少对底层供应商的依赖,更倾向于将报文解析放在应用层处理,通过接口模型对应用层和底层软件的信号进行传输。然而接口模型都是软件工程师手动搭建而成,标准化低,而且需要花费大量的时间用于建模和测试,导致模型搭建效率低下。

技术实现思路

[0003]本专利技术的主要目的在于提供一种模型生成方法、设备和存储介质,旨在改善模型搭建效率低下的问题。
[0004]为实现上述目的,本专利技术提供的一种模型生成方法,所述模型生成方法包括以下步骤:
[0005]获取预设模型和界面对应的数据词典;
[0006]根据预设模型和所述数据词典生成所述界面的一级框架;
[0007]获取接口信号对应的接口类型,并获取所述接口信号对应的信号类型;
[0008]根据所述接口类型和所述信号类型生成信号处理的二级框架。
[0009]可选地,所述根据所述接口类型和所述信号类型生成信号处理的二级框架的步骤之后,还包括:
[0010]若所述接口类型为输入接口,且所述信号类型为报文信号时,则读取并解包所述输入接口的接口信号;
[0011]生成第一标定开关;
[0012]当所述第一标定开关为开启状态时,根据预设的第一标定量和所述接口信号生成标定后的接口信号。
[0013]可选地,所述根据预设的第一标定量和所述接口信号生成标定后的接口信号的步骤之后,还包括:
[0014]根据预设的故障检测算法对所述报文信号进行故障检测,得到所述报文信号的故障检测结果;
[0015]确定所述故障检测结果的替代指令;
[0016]根据所述故障检测算法和所述替代指令生成所述二级框架对应的三级框架。
[0017]可选地,所述根据所述故障检测算法和所述替代指令生成所述二级框架对应的三级框架的步骤之后,还包括:
[0018]在对所述接口信号进行故障检测后,在预设的映射表查询所述接口信号的映射关系;
[0019]若查询到所述接口信号的映射关系,则根据预设的命名规范对所述接口信号的名称进行更新;
[0020]输出更新后的所述接口信号和所述故障检测结果。
[0021]可选地,所述根据所述接口类型和所述信号类型生成信号处理的二级框架的步骤之后,还包括:
[0022]若所述接口类型为输入接口,且所述信号类型为硬线信号时,则读取所述输入接口的接口信号;
[0023]生成第二标定开关;
[0024]当所述第二标定开关为开启状态时,根据预设的第二标定量和所述接口信号生成标定后的接口信号。
[0025]可选地,所述根据预设的第二标定量和所述接口信号生成标定后的接口信号的步骤之后,还包括:
[0026]根据硬线信号的信号种类确定所述硬线信号对应的故障检测参数,所述信号种类包括模拟信号或者数字信号;
[0027]根据所述故障检测参数对所述硬线信号进行检测,得到故障检测结果;
[0028]确定所述故障检测结果的替代指令;
[0029]根据所述故障检测参数和所述替代指令生成所述二级框架对应的三级框架。
[0030]可选地,所述确定所述故障检测结果的替代指令的步骤之前,还包括:
[0031]若所述硬线信号为模拟信号,则将所述接口信号的模拟量转化为物理量。
[0032]可选地,所述根据所述故障检测参数和所述替代指令生成所述二级框架对应的三级框架的步骤之后,还包括:
[0033]在对所述接口信号进行故障检测后,在预设的映射表查询所述接口信号的映射关系;
[0034]若查询到所述接口信号的映射关系,则根据预设的命名规范对所述接口信号的名称进行更新;
[0035]输出更新后的所述接口信号和所述故障检测结果。
[0036]为实现上述目的,本专利技术还提供一种模型生成设备,所述模型生成设备包括存储器、处理器以及存储在所述存储器并可在所述处理器上执行的模型生成程序,所述模型生成程序被所述处理器执行时实现如上所述的模型生成方法的各个步骤。
[0037]为实现上述目的,本专利技术还提供一种计算机可读存储介质,所述计算机可读存储介质存储有模型生成程序,所述模型生成程序被处理器执行时实现如上所述的模型生成方法的各个步骤。
[0038]本专利技术提供的一种模型生成方法、设备和存储介质,获取预设模型和界面对应的数据词典;根据预设模型和数据词典生成界面的一级框架;获取接口信号对应的接口类型,并获取接口信号对应的信号类型;根据接口类型和信号类型生成信号处理的二级框架。通过建模得到一级框架和二级框架,提高了模型的生成效率,通过模型实现对接口信号的信号处理,提高接口信号传输的安全性和处理效率,节省人力成本和时间成本。
附图说明
[0039]图1为本专利技术实施例涉及的模型生成设备的硬件结构示意图;
[0040]图2为本专利技术模型生成方法的第一实施例的流程示意图;
[0041]图3为本专利技术模型生成方法的接口模型的示意图;
[0042]图4为本专利技术模型生成方法的三级框架的示意图;
[0043]图5为本专利技术模型生成方法的第二实施例的流程示意图;
[0044]图6为本专利技术模型生成方法的第三实施例的流程示意图;
[0045]图7为本专利技术模型生成方法的第四实施例的流程示意图。
[0046]本专利技术目的的实现、功能特点及优点将结合实施例,参照附图做进一步说明。
具体实施方式
[0047]应当理解,此处所描述的具体实施例仅仅用以解释本专利技术,并不用于限定本专利技术。
[0048]本专利技术实施例的主要解决方案是:获取预设模型和界面对应的数据词典;根据预设模型和数据词典生成界面的一级框架;获取接口信号对应的接口类型,并获取接口信号对应的信号类型;根据接口类型和信号类型生成信号处理的二级框架。
[0049]通过建模得到一级框架和二级框架,提高了模型的生成效率,通过模型实现对接口信号的信号处理,提高接口信号传输的安全性和处理效率,节省人力成本和时间成本。
[0050]作为一种实现方案,模型生成设备可以如图1所示。
[0051]本专利技术实施例方案涉及的是模型生成设备,模型生成设备包括:处理器101,例如CPU,存储器102,通信总线103。其中,通信总线103用于实现这些组件之间的连接通信。
[0052]存储器102可以是高速RAM存储器,也可以是稳定的存储器(non

volatilememory),例如磁盘存储器。如图1所示,作为一种计算机可读存储介质的存储器102中可以包括模型生成程序;而处理器101可以用于调用存储器102中存储的模型生成程序,并执行以下操作:本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种模型生成方法,其特征在于,所述模型生成方法包括:获取预设模型和界面对应的数据词典;根据预设模型和所述数据词典生成所述模型的一级框架;获取接口信号对应的接口类型,并获取所述接口信号对应的信号类型;根据所述接口类型和所述信号类型生成信号处理的二级框架。2.如权利要求1所述的模型生成方法,其特征在于,所述根据所述接口类型和所述信号类型生成信号处理的二级框架的步骤之后,还包括:若所述接口类型为输入接口,且所述信号类型为报文信号时,则读取并解包所述输入接口的接口信号;生成第一标定开关;当所述第一标定开关为开启状态时,根据预设的第一标定量和所述接口信号生成标定后的接口信号。3.如权利要求2所述的模型生成方法,其特征在于,所述根据预设的第一标定量和所述接口信号生成标定后的接口信号的步骤之后,还包括:根据预设的故障检测算法对所述报文信号进行故障检测,得到所述报文信号的故障检测结果;确定所述故障检测结果的替代指令;根据所述故障检测算法和所述替代指令生成所述二级框架对应的三级框架。4.如权利要求3所述的模型生成方法,其特征在于,所述根据所述故障检测算法和所述替代指令生成所述二级框架对应的三级框架的步骤之后,还包括:在对所述接口信号进行故障检测后,在预设的映射表查询所述接口信号的映射关系;若查询到所述接口信号的映射关系,则根据预设的命名规范对所述接口信号的名称进行更新;输出更新后的所述接口信号和所述故障检测结果。5.如权利要求1所述的模型生成方法,其特征在于,所述根据所述接口类型和所述信号类型生成信号处理的二级框架的步骤之后,还包括:若所述接口类型为输入接口,且所述信号类型为硬线信号时,则读取所述输入接口的接口信号;生成第二标定开关...

【专利技术属性】
技术研发人员:姚波善林海城刘寅童侯聪
申请(专利权)人:广东汇天航空航天科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1